BoaVida is a national operator of Manufactured Home and RV Communities based in Sacramento. Our portfolio of 250 properties is concentrated in California, but our locations span from coast to coast. We are currently seeking qualified candidates for a Human Resources Specialist to join our team of over 500 associates to manage and implement various human resources programs. Duties:
- Administer and enforce the implementation of HR strategies, programs, policies, and procedures.
- Maintain knowledge and understanding of Federal and State labor laws to ensure compliance with all HR related legal and regulatory requirements and administer changes as needed.
- Maintain OSHA policies and compliance.
- Execute employee relations duties, staff communication, performance improvement plans.
- Coach Regional Managers in effective personnel management practices.
- Maintain employee files.
- Assist with benefit administration (dental and vision).
- Manage Workers’ Compensation, Unemployment, and Disability claims for multiple states.
- Administer new hire onboarding and off boarding of employees.
- Responsible for all recruiting efforts to include job descriptions, posting jobs, reviewing resumes, scheduling interviews, background checks and drug screenings.
- Government reporting, such as EEO, CA Pay data, etc.
- Identify, design, and update HR related training.
- Assist with semi-monthly payroll processing.
